47 /* There are three distinct validation levels defined here: */
49 /* FT_VALIDATE_DEFAULT :: */
50 /* A table that passes this validation level can be used reliably by */
51 /* FreeType. It generally means that all offsets have been checked to */
52 /* prevent out-of-bound reads, that array counts are correct, etc. */
54 /* FT_VALIDATE_TIGHT :: */
55 /* A table that passes this validation level can be used reliably and */
56 /* doesn't contain invalid data. For example, a charmap table that */
57 /* returns invalid glyph indices will not pass, even though it can */
58 /* be used with FreeType in default mode (the library will simply */
59 /* return an error later when trying to load the glyph). */
61 /* It also checks that fields which must be a multiple of 2, 4, or 8, */
62 /* don't have incorrect values, etc. */
64 /* FT_VALIDATE_PARANOID :: */
65 /* Only for font debugging. Checks that a table follows the */
66 /* specification by 100%. Very few fonts will be able to pass this */
67 /* level anyway but it can be useful for certain tools like font */
68 /* editors/converters. */

117 /* Sets the error field in a validator, then calls `longjmp' to return */
118 /* to high-level caller. Using `setjmp/longjmp' avoids many stupid */
119 /* error checks within the validation routines. */
